Though 80% in a four-way vote is actually worse than 94% in a 3 way vote, if you do the maths.
In a 3 way eviction you need over 33.3%
In a 4 way eviction you need over 25%
94 divided by 33.3 = 2.82 times more than the needed percentage to be evicted.
79.4 divided by 25 = 3.176 times more than the needed percentage to be evicted.
Therefore, Pauline's percentage is worse than what Nicole got in a 3 way vote.
Also, Nikki's eviction result in BB7 was quiet a landslide, when she was up with 11 housemates. She got 37.2% in a vote to evict.
In an eleven-way eviction, you need just over 9.09% to guarantee your eviction.
37.2 divided by 9.09 = 4.09 times more than the needed percentage to be evicted.
In theory, Nikki's eviction percentage in a eleven-way vote is far worse than what Nicole or Pauline got, in 3 and 4 way evictions.
Nicole may have had the highest actual percentage, but it wasn't as bad as what Nikki or Pauline got, in their evictions.
